Use the following procedure when you connect to the GUI for the first time.
To Connect to the GUI
1. Connect the device's
MGMT port
Ethernet
cable.
If connecting to the device directly, use a crossover Ethernet cable. If connecting to
the device through a hub or switch, use a straight-through Ethernet cable.
2. Configure the management computer to be on the same
interface as the FortiBridge unit:
IP address:
192.168.1.XXX
Netmask:
255.255.255.0
3. Visit
192.168.1.99
in your web browser.
4. Login using username
"admin"
and no password.
5.
Configure your device
and save your settings.
